On Easter Sunday, a two-year-old in Jacksonville accidentally shot himself with an unsecured firearm. According to the Jacksonville Sheriff's Office Facebook page, the incident occurred around 7 p.m. in the Wesconnett area. Despite efforts to save the child, he did not survive.

The Jacksonville Sheriff's Office expressed condolences to the family and emphasized the importance of gun safety in homes. They highlighted the availability of free gun locks at their substations and urged firearm owners to securely store their weapons to prevent accidents.

They also encouraged gun safety education, with resources provided by organizations like Project ChildSafe and Nemours.
